aberrant

UK /əˈbɛɹ.ənt/ US /əˈbɛɹ.ənt/
adj 3noun 2

Definitions

adj

1

Differing from the norm.

2

Straying from the right way; deviating from morality or truth.

3

Deviating from the ordinary or natural type; exceptional; abnormal.

The more aberrant any form is, the greater must have been the number of connecting forms which, on my theory, have been exterminated.

noun

1

A person or object that deviates from the rest of a group.

2

A group, individual, or structure that deviates from the usual or natural type, especially with an atypical chromosome number.
